TEXO Recruitment are delighted to be supporting our client, a respected operator within the UK logistics and infrastructure sector, in the recruitment of a Light Vehicle Technician, based at Teesport on a permanent basis.

This is an exciting opportunity to join a forward-thinking engineering team within a nationally recognised business committed to operational excellence, safety, and employee development.

Job Purpose:

As a Vehicle Technician, you’ll be responsible for the service, repair, troubleshooting, and maintenance of a range of fleet assets, including:

  • Electric and diesel light commercial vans
  • Electric and diesel UTVs (Utility Task Vehicles)
  • Diesel Mobile Elevated Work Platforms (MEWPs) – training will be provided if required

Working both in the workshop and on-site as needed, you’ll respond to vehicle breakdowns, carry out preventative maintenance, and ensure assets are maintained to the highest operational and safety standards. Knowledge of EV systems is advantageous; however, training will be provided where applicable.

Skills, Qualifications & Experience:

  • Minimum 5 years’ experience in the light commercial or HGV sector post-apprenticeship
  • Excellent mechanical and electrical fault-finding skills
  • Strong understanding of diagnostic systems and vehicle components
  • Ability to plan workload and support/supervise others
  • High attention to detail and commitment to safety standards
  • Clear and confident communication skills
  • Experience in a logistics, industrial, or port environment – desirable
  • Analytical mindset to interpret repair data and performance history

Responsibilities:

  • Diagnose faults using tools and technical knowledge
  • Carry out repairs and component replacements across vehicle systems
  • Complete routine servicing, fluid checks, tyre replacements and wheel alignments
  • Maintain and repair vehicle air conditioning and heating systems
  • Work safely with high-voltage systems in EVs (training available)
  • Respond quickly to on-site breakdowns to minimise downtime
  • Ensure compliance with all health and safety guidance, including HAVS
  • Support workshop efficiency and maintain strong housekeeping standards
  • Accurately complete job sheets and service records
  • Supervise external contractors when required
